Sustainable Development Goals: Transforming Our World

The United Nations' Agenda for Sustainable Development are a transformative set of objectives adopted by all member states of the United Nations in September 2015. These 17 interconnected targets aim to eradicate poverty, protect our planet, and ensure prosperity for all by that deadline.

The SDGs cover a diverse spectrum of topics, including ending poverty, combating inequality, and protecting our planet. They are all mutually reinforcing, meaning that achieving one goal can have positive ripple effects across other goals .

The Complex Web of the Sustainable Development Goals

Achieving a sustainable future demands a holistic strategy that understands the inherently interconnected nature of the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s). Each goal encompasses a critical component of human well-being and planetary health, and progress in one area frequently positively impacts others. For example, investing in renewable energy to mitigate climate change not only diminishes greenhouse gas emissions but also enhances air quality, promotes economic growth, and provides new job opportunities. This interdependence underscores the necessity of adopting a unified approach to SDG implementation, ensuring that progress in one area contributes progress across the entire set.
